Review about the Chapel of The Apparitions in Fatima Portugal

The Chapel of The Apparitions in Fatima is considered one of the most important Shrines in the World for Catholics, and the second most important shrine in Europe, after the Vatican.
It was here, on this place, that Our Lady appeared to the three little children in 1917, one hundred years ago.
On this exact same place, existed a tree, where Virgin Mary appeared for several times between May and October 1917.

The last apparition was seen by 70.000 people, who witnessed the miracle of the Sun, on the place that today hosts the Sanctuary. The square of the Sanctuary is two times St Peter Square in Vatican. Two of the Children (Jacinta and Francisco), have been canonized in 2017 by Pope Francis on this visit to Fatima, and are now the Youngest Saints (non-martyrs) of the Catholic Church.

 

 
The Chapel of the Apparitions was built for the first time in 1919 and finalized/opened in 1921, but one year later, 1922, republican people against the church, dinamited the chapel and totally destroyed the building.
By the end of 1922, the new chapel was rebuilt, and today is visited every year by millions of people from all over the world (2017 had 9.4 million people, on opposite to the Vatican that received 10 million visitors).

You can also visit together with the Chapel Of The Apparitions, the following places: Basilica or Our Lady of the Rosary, Most Holy Trinity Basilica, Candle Procession/Lighting, Houses of the Children, Museum of Fatima, Berlin Wall, and much more.
